
Lucky Bunny
Location: The Vista Mall
2401 S Stemmons Fwy # 1136
Lewisville, TX 75067
(near the playground and
zion food court)*Currently we are NOT ACCEPTING event bookings at our spaceSTORE HOURS
SATURDAY - SUNDAY NOON-6PM
Location: The Vista Mall
2401 S Stemmons Fwy # 1136
Lewisville, TX 75067
(near the playground and
zion food court)*Currently we are NOT ACCEPTING event bookings at our spaceSTORE HOURS
SATURDAY - SUNDAY NOON-6PM